Mary, You will normally gain some weight back when you end a fast and that varies by the person and the fast. On my 46-day fast I had lost 34.4 lb and have gained back about 8.2, that represents 26.2 lb lost net during the fast.

Your choice of foods will determine how much you gain back. I am avoiding eating real carby foods, other than the 90% chocolate I have been snacking on! I am going to try to avoid those the next few days as well.

I never had issues with constipation, it was always the other way around with the 7-10 day fasts. Things seemed to move through very quickly although the instances were short lived.
